    Keating eliminated one shy of the money

    • Level: 19
    • Small Blind: 4K
    • Big Blind: 8K
    • BB Ante: 8K
    • Chip Average: 307K
    • Remaining: 103
    • Entries: 792

    2018/11/02 | 13:59 by Playground Poker

    Alexander Keating was crippled shortly before hand-for-hand began, after his King of Hearts Jack of Hearts was bested by King of Spades King of Diamonds. He was left with only 30,000 chips, which went in to the middle during the first hand on the bubble. Richard Alsup isolated him next to act by moving all-in himself, and the rest of the table got out of the way.

    Alexander: Ace of Hearts 10 of Clubs
    Richard: Ace of Spades Queen of Hearts

    Both players flopped two-pairs, but Richard ended up scooping the pot on the Queen of Clubs Ace of Diamonds 10 of Hearts 2 of Diamonds Queen of Spades board to bring the field into the money.

    The remainder of the field is now guaranteed at a payout of at least $11,400, much to the content of Darryll Fish, who was sitting with under 3 big blinds when hand-for-hand started.

    Cedolia doubles through Little

    • Level: 19
    • Small Blind: 4K
    • Big Blind: 8K
    • BB Ante: 8K
    • Chip Average: 301K
    • Remaining: 105
    • Entries: 792

    2018/11/02 | 13:36 by

    Gianluca Cedolia has just doubled through Jonathan Little on table 28 to give himself a few more chips to try and make his way through the bubble.

    Jonathan opened the action with a raise to 20K from utg+2. Gianluca, sitting directly to his left, threw in a time chip with 15 seconds left, and used most of the time before shoving his last 44K. The remaining players folded and Jonathan made the call.

    Jonathan: King of Diamonds 10 of Hearts
    Gianluca: King of Hearts King of Clubs

    The board ran out perfectly for the pocket Kings: 2 of Diamonds Queen of Spades 3 of Diamonds Ace of Hearts 10 of Clubs and Gianluca moves forward to the bubble with just over 10bb.

    Set over set sends Mandanici-Turcot to the rail

    • Level: 18
    • Small Blind: 3K
    • Big Blind: 6K
    • BB Ante: 6K
    • Chip Average: 282K
    • Remaining: 112
    • Entries: 792

    2018/11/02 | 13:06 by Playground Poker

    Jason Mandanici-Turcot was just eliminated from the Main Event in an inevitable cooler. He clashed with Harpreet Padda on the turn of a 7 of Spades 3 of Hearts 4 of Spades 8 of Clubs board, where the majority of the 600,000 pot was formed, only for find out that his flopped top set was second best to Harpreet’s turned set.

    Once the all-in occurred, Jason tabled 7 of Clubs 7 of Diamonds and was down to just one out to keep his seat in the Main Event, as Harpreet was holding 8 of Spades 8 of Diamonds. As the river Jack of Hearts was a blank, Jason was sent to the rail 10 spots shy of the payouts.

    The Action clock is now being introduced into play.

    Leah takes (more) from Tran; the Action Clock is here

    • Level: 18
    • Small Blind: 3K
    • Big Blind: 6K
    • BB Ante: 6K
    • Chip Average: 283K
    • Remaining: 112
    • Entries: 792

    2018/11/02 | 12:57 by

    Mike Leah continues to accumulate at the expense of Nghi Van “Henry” Tran. We arrived at the table on the turn on a board reading: 5 of Clubs King of Diamonds 4 of Diamonds 9 of Clubs to find that Mike had check-raised all in to a bet of 75K by Tran, who was on the button. Tran thought long and hard about the decision and was obviously unsure of what to do. Eventually time was called and before the clock ran out, Tran folded. He now has just 270K in his stack.

    Meanwhile, 2 more players have been eliminated taking the field to 112 players remaining – time for the WPT Action Clock! Every player will have 30 seconds to compete each action, and has been given 4 time extension chips they may use to extend their time by another 30 seconds each. The clock has been paused briefly as this new element in the tournament is being added to each table – play will resume momentarily.
